Why Exact Fajemirokun Net Worth Remains Hidden
Private family wealth in Nigeria rarely gets disclosed publicly. Unlike public corporations, conglomerates controlled by families are not obligated to publish financials.
This opacity fuels wild online speculation. People fill the vacuum with estimates. Then other sites copy those estimates as facts. The cycle repeats endlessly.
Even Forbes and Bloomberg do not maintain an active, detailed profile on the Fajemirokun family's current net worth.
